Direct Computation of Cubic Spline Interpolation for Real-Time Image Codec

摘要

In this paper, the cubic spline interpolation (CSI) is shown to be performed by a direct computation for the encoding and decoding processes of image coding. A pipeline structure can be used to implement this new CSI. Such a new CSI algorithm can be used along with the JPEG standard to obtain the new CSI-JPEG codec and while still maintaining good quality of the reconstructed image for higher compression ratios. In this paper, it is shown that this new CSI-JPEG codec makes possible a pipeline compression algorithm that is naturally suitable for hardware implementation.
